36560010415 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 43873098048. Its totient is φ = 29247284640.
The previous prime is 36560010407. The next prime is 36560010427. The reversal of 36560010415 is 51401006563.
36560010415 is digitally balanced in base 2, because in such base it contains all the possibile digits an equal number of times.
It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 36560010415 - 23 = 36560010407 is a prime.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 244725 + ... + 364705.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(5484137256).
Almost surely, 236560010415 is an apocalyptic number.
36560010415 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(7313087633).
36560010415 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
36560010415 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 180929.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 10800, while the sum is 31.
Adding to 36560010415 its reverse (51401006563), we get a palindrome (87961016978).
The spelling of 36560010415 in words is "thirty-six billion, five hundred sixty million, ten thousand, four hundred fifteen".
